Cisco is committed to connecting, training, and hiring U.S. military veterans. Cisco’s Veterans Program focuses on hiring military veterans, easing their transition to civilian life, and connecting them with educational and career opportunities in the technology field. By 2016, more than 1 million U.S. military personnel are expected to transition to civilian life, including approximately 300,000 by August 2013. Cisco supports U.S. veterans through education and employment opportunities and is a founding member of the 100,000 Jobs Mission, a coalition of more than 80 corporations committed to collectively hiring 100,000 U.S. veterans by 2020.
